The first two LNG ships, built specifically for the needs of the Polish Oil and Gas Industry (PGNiG), will enter service in 2023. Two more will start work in 2024, and in 2025, four new gas carriers will be commissioned. In total, the PGNiG Group has ordered eight such units.

Both long-term contracts with Venture Global are based on FOB formula. In order to receive gas under these contracts, PGNiG has started to develop its own fleet of LNG tankers. It has chartered eight LNGCs, each with a capacity of 174,000 tonnes, that will be built exclusively for PGNiG.
On 16 May, Sempra Infrastructure said it entered into a heads of agreement (HOA) with PGNiG for the purchase of approximately three million tonnes per annum (MTPA) of LNG. The cargo will be delivered free-on-board from Sempra Infrastructure’s portfolio of LNG projects in North America.
